引言
近年来,区块链技术的急速发展使其在各行各业中的应用变得愈发广泛,尤其是在制造业。区块链不仅能够提高生产效率,降低成本,还能为数据透明性、追溯性和安全性提供强有力的保障。本文将详细探讨区块链平台的制造流程,从需求分析到最终的部署与维护,逐步带您理解每一个环节及其重要性。
一、需求分析
区块链平台的制造流程首先从需求分析开始。这个环节对于后续一切工作的开展至关重要。企业需要明确希望通过区块链技术解决的问题,比方说供应链管理、产品追溯、智能合约等。
在此阶段,团队需要进行市场调研,了解现有系统的不足之处,以及如何通过区块链来提升现有系统的运作效率。收集利益相关者的需求也是此阶段的重要工作,以便确保开发出的系统能够满足所有相关方的期望。
二、设计与规划
一旦需求明确,团队便进入设计与规划阶段。此时,首先需要确定所使用的区块链平台。例如,以太坊、Hyperledger Fabric、EOS等都是当前比较主流的选择。每种平台都具有不同的特点和优劣,团队需要结合自身的需求做出选择。
设计有效的网络架构也是这个阶段的重要组成部分。参与者的节点、权限的设置、信息的传递方式等,都应被系统地考虑和规划。设计文档的编写将为后续的开发提供必要的参考和指导。
三、技术实现
技术实现阶段是整个制造流程中的核心,主要包括智能合约的编写、前端用户界面的设计和后端架构的搭建。在这一过程中,开发团队需要合理使用编程语言,比如Solidity(用于以太坊的智能合约)或Go(用于Hyperledger Fabric)。
智能合约的功能设计应充分反映出需求分析时确定的目标,如自动化的交易、条件触发的操作等。同时,安全性也不容忽视,开发者需要对代码进行严谨的测试以避免潜在的漏洞。
除了后端的实现,用户界面设计也至关重要。用户体验直接影响到平台的推广和使用,简洁而有效的设计能够大幅提高用户满意度,从而增强用户的黏性。
四、测试与调整
在技术实现完成后,团队需要对平台进行全面的测试。这一环节包括单元测试、集成测试、压力测试等多个方面,以确保不同模块在各种条件下都能正常运作。
通过测试发现的问题需要及时记录并进行调整,这个过程中应保持团队的紧密合作。测试反馈对于下次迭代和升级非常重要,能够帮助团队不断改进产品。
五、部署与维护
经过充分的测试,大部分问题得到解决后,区块链平台就可以进入部署阶段。这需要开发团队与运维团队的紧密合作,确保所有的设置和配置都准确无误。同时,部署后还需要定期进行维护,以应对不断变化的市场和技术环境。
定期的系统评估和问题分析将帮助团队预见潜在的技术挑战,及时作出调整,从而保障平台的稳定运作。用户反馈也是平台的重要信息来源,应该被重视并纳入后续的开发计划中。
可能相关的问题分析
区块链平台的安全性如何保障?
在开发区块链平台时,一切从安全出发是至关重要的。区块链天然具有的数据不可篡改性,但这并不意味着平台不需要额外的安全措施。
首先,从软件层面而言,务必确保代码审计,通过专业工具或团队对智能合约进行全面检查,发现并修复潜在的安全漏洞。同时,权限管理是保证安全的另一重要方面,确保只有授权用户才能进行某些敏感操作。
其次,网络安全也同样重要。防火墙、入侵检测系统(IDS)等防护措施可以有效阻止外部攻击。此外,多重签名技术能够进一步加强安全性,确保资金和数据的安全。
最后,备份机制也是一个不容忽视的方面。定期备份数据可以确保在遭受攻击或其他灾害时的数据恢复。整体而言,安全性不仅是开发的首要考虑,也需要在后续维护过程中不断进行审查和强化。
供应链管理中如何实现区块链的优势?
在传统的供应链管理中,由于多个环节的复杂性和信息的不对称,常常会出现延误、纠纷和信息不透明的问题。而区块链技术正好可以解决这些痛点。
首先,区块链允许各个供应链参与方实时共享数据,确保信息的透明性和一致性。这意味着,所有参与者都可以追溯到商品的原产地及所有流转路径,提升产品的追溯能力。尤其在食品和药品行业,这一优势尤为明显。
进一步来说,智能合约能够自动监管合同履行,确保各方在约定的条件下自动交易,无需人为干预,这不仅提高了效率,更减少了纠纷产生的机会。
最后,区块链的去中心化特质极大降低了中介的需求,使得供应链成本得以大幅降低。制造企业能够在保障效率的同时,减少不必要的开支。
如何选择适合自己企业的区块链平台?
选择适合自己的区块链平台是企业在开展区块链项目时的重中之重。首先,需要明确自己的需求,如是否需要公有链、私有链还是联盟链。不同类型的区块链平台在数据访问权限、速度、控制权等方面存在显著差异。
其次,企业应考虑现有的技术栈及团队的技术能力。某些平台可能需要特定的编程语言及框架,与现有团队的技能相匹配将减少培训成本和时间。
此外,平台的社区支持与生态系统也非常重要。活跃的社区能够提供更多的资源、插件和技术支持,方便企业在项目开发中及时解决问题。
最后,考虑到后续的扩展性和灵活性也是选型的重要标准。企业需要看平台是否能够支持功能的扩展,适应未来的业务需求和技术变化。
区块链技术在未来的制造业中将扮演什么角色?
区块链技术在未来的制造业中,将可能成为基础设施的一部分。随着物联网(IoT)与人工智能(AI)的发展,生产和供应链的数字化转型将加速,而区块链则为整个过程提供了可信的数据基础。
首先,智能制造将依赖区块链技术实现设备间的数据共享与协作,实时监测生产状态,生产流程,提效降本。此外,当市场需求变化时,区块链将帮助企业迅速调整生产计划,实现更高的灵活性。
其次,区块链将进一步增强供应链的透明性与可追溯性,保障产品质量。在产品召回等情况下,能够迅速追溯到问题环节,减少损失和风险,保障消费者的信任。
最后,从长远来看,区块链将促进各类业务协作和资源共享,构建新型的生态系统。通过合约与自动化执行,企业之间可以更高效地开展合作,形成共赢局面。
总结
区块链平台的制造流程涵盖需求分析、设计与规划、技术实现、测试与调整以及部署与维护等多个环节。每一个阶段都对最终平台的成功与否起到重要作用。通过合理运用区块链技术,企业能够在提高生产效率、降低运营成本、增强数据透明性等方面获得显著成效。未来,区块链将在制造业中发挥越来越重要的作用,推动行业的数字转型与创新发展。希望本文的详细介绍能够为相关从业者提供指导和启发。
